Overview of Deposit Options: Fiat and Crypto Currencies

When exploring deposit options, users often weigh the benefits of fiat and crypto currencies. Fiat currencies, such as USD or EUR, typically offer a more familiar pathway for users. They come with established banking security measures, making them appealing for those prioritizing financial privacy. However, transaction fees can vary, and local payment solutions may influence withdrawal times and processing efficiency.

On the other hand, crypto currenc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um are gaining traction due to their decentralized nature. They can provide quicker transaction times and lower minimum deposits, appealing to tech-savvy users. Yet, volatility remains a concern, and potential users must consider their preferences regarding risk.

Ultimately, the choice between fiat and crypto currencies hinges on individual requirements, including transaction fees, withdrawal times, and desired levels of financial privacy. Understanding these factors will empower users to make informed decisions that align with their financial goals.

Understanding Withdrawal Times and Processing Efficiency

When navigating the world of online transactions, understanding withdrawal times is crucial for users. Different deposit options and local payment solutions play significant roles in determining how quickly funds are accessible. For instance, while bank transfers may take several days, e-wallets often process transactions within hours, catering to varying user preferences.

Efficiency doesn’t just hinge on speed; it also involves the intricacies of banking security and financial privacy. With the rise of both fiat and crypto currencies, users need to be aware of the potential transaction fees associated with different methods. Some platforms may impose fees for quicker withdrawals, influencing a user’s choice.

Moreover, understanding minimum deposits can impact the overall experience. Users should always check the terms of service to ensure they are making informed decisions, especially when it comes to processing efficiency. By being aware of these variables, users can better navigate their financial transactions.
